摘要
The luminescence properties of the In1-xLuxBO3:Bi3+ (0 less than or equal to x less than or equal to 1) solid solutions were studied. In the concentration range 0 < x less than or equal to 0.30 both the emission of Bi3+ ions and the emission due to an annihilation of the impurity-trapped excitons are observed. The impurity-trapped exciton band shifts towards higher energies with increasing x. At x > 0.30 only emission of Bi3+ centers is observed. This behavior is correlated with increasing band gap energy of the solid solutions and can be described in terms of configuration coordinate curve diagrams.
